- [ ] **Step 7: Breaker override escrow.** After sealing the signing keys for the Tallgrove upstream API circuit breaker, confirm the support team can force the breaker open during a full outage. The override bundle lives in the sealed escrow drawer and is useless without its unlock phrase. Two ceremony witnesses must initial this step before proceeding. The escrow bundle is decrypted with the recovery passphrase that follows.

vault phrase of kahip-kahop = holath-quenmir

Re: Retirement of the Stonebriar product line

Stonebriar sales have declined for five consecutive quarters and support costs now exceed contribution margin. The retirement plan is staged: new orders close end of Q2, existing contracts honoured through their terms, and spares stocked for twenty-four months. Sales leads should steer prospects toward the Ashgrove range; migration incentives are already approved. Customer comms are drafted and awaiting legal sign-off. The forward strategy behind this decision is set out in the note below.

confidential, yafog-hagug: Gross margin on Druix came in at 10 percent against a plan of 15 percent. Only 5 of the 80 pilot accounts renewed Druix, so a churn review is set for October 1.

## Configuration

The Brindlewick sweeper prunes expired records on a rolling schedule, so heads up: retention windows are set per-collection in `sweeper.toml`, and anything without an explicit window falls back to the 90-day default. Deletions are soft for 14 days, then purged for real. The sweeper authenticates to the Hollowmere audit sink before every run, and that credential lives in your env file. Add the following line:

secret setting of yafof-tawep: RELAY_SECRET8=8abb5772

## Undo/Redo Notes — Chartling Editor

Undo stack lives in `history/stack.ts`. Redo is a mirrored stack, cleared on any new mutation. Max depth is HISTORY_MAX_DEPTH, default 100. Reviewers: reject PRs that mutate nodes outside `applyCommand`, or undo breaks silently. Session replay for debugging requires the replay service token, which is set on the next line of the env file.

sealed setting: LEDGER_TOKEN13=5d842615a26d7